The Benefits of Construction Safety Apps

Real-time Access to Safety Information

  • Construction safety apps provide workers with easy access to important safety information such as safety guidelines, procedures, and protocols.
  • Workers can quickly reference safety information on their mobile devices, ensuring that they are following the necessary protocols while on the job.

Incident Reporting

  • Construction safety apps allow workers to report incidents in real-time, ensuring that issues are addressed promptly.
  • Incident reports can be submitted directly through the app, providing a streamlined process for reporting and documenting safety concerns.

Training and Education

  • Construction safety apps can be used to provide training materials and resources to workers, ensuring that they are aware of safety protocols and procedures.
  • Workers can access training modules and educational resources through the app, allowing them to stay updated on safety best practices.

Key Features of Construction Safety Apps

Checklists and Inspections

  • Many construction safety apps offer customizable checklists and inspection forms that workers can use to ensure that safety protocols are being followed.
  • Checklists can be completed directly on the app, with the ability to add notes and photos for documentation purposes.

Emergency Response

  • Construction safety apps often include features for emergency response, such as emergency contact information and procedures for handling emergencies.
  • In the event of an emergency, workers can quickly access the necessary information through the app to ensure a prompt and coordinated response.

Communication and Collaboration

  • Construction safety apps facilitate communication and collaboration among workers and supervisors, allowing for real-time updates and notifications regarding safety issues.
  • Workers can use the app to communicate safety concerns, receive updates on safety procedures, and collaborate with colleagues to address safety issues effectively.
